Join us for our November meeting of the Blue Ridge Chapter of the NC Native Plant Society!Wednesday, November 12 at the BREMCO (Blue Ridge Energy) Conference Room in Boone.
Our speaker, Brandon Wise, Deputy Director of Boone Planning and Inspections, will present “Town of Boone Efforts to Encourage Native Plants and Clear Out Invasives.”
Brandon will share an inside look at how the Town of Boone is working to promote the use of native plants, manage invasive species, and incorporate ecological practices into local planning and development. He’ll also discuss recent updates to the Town’s Unified Development Ordinance (UDO) and how community members can get involved in these ongoing efforts.
Brandon graduated from Appalachian State University in 2015 with a degree in Ecological, Environmental, and Evolutionary Biology. He has worked in environmental consulting, stormwater management, and regulatory compliance, and now oversees permitting, stormwater, and erosion control inspections for the Town of Boone.
